Job Summary

On a shared basis, provide a wide variety of office support tasks to the Directors and staffs of the two Centers and support for the teaching, research, and engagement activities organized by and relevant to the two Centers.

Duties & Responsibilities

  • Responsible for ensuring all financial payments are executed in accordance with University business policies
    and completed within established timelines for payment. Become proficient in the TEM system, Chrome River,
    iBuy, My UI Financials, Contracts+, inventory, and various other University platforms required effective
    business operations.
  • Work closely with assigned units' staff to ensure grant and or endowment funds are being spent in accordance
    with both University and federal and/or external grant requirements, and/or donor intent. Assist with issuing
    award letters to students, faculty, and external organizations regarding annual fund allocations. Demonstrate
    basic fiscal knowledge of budgets and maintains up-to-date filing system of required receipts and back-up
    documentation.
  • Assist with the daily operation of the Centers, working closely with assigned units' staff; act as a confidential
    assistant in all matters; maintain calendars. Coordinate meetings including securing meeting space, preparing
    agendas, and recording and distributing minutes and notify individuals regarding committee appointments.
  • Provide building operations support including managing key access for all twelve IGI departments, lock and
    unlock shared space, mange conference rooms reservation calendars, and serve as point of contact for
    building requests when needed.
  • Coordinate, monitor progress of, and complete logistics, budget, travel arrangements: honoraria forms:
    reimbursement, room reservations, catering requests and other arrangements for events. Help arrange for
    speakers by issuing invitations to speak and following up on publicity details such as presenters' biographies
    and abstracts; assist with developing publicity and background materials.
  • Receive and process confidential materials for fellowships, scholarships, and MA admissions (when applicable)
    as well as grant.
  • Provide information to students, faculty, and departments and visitors.
  • Serve as point of contact between students, faculty, visitors and the general public and Center Staff. Answer
    incoming phone calls and manages email accounts. Collect and prioritize daily postal mail and email. Respond
    independently to routine inquiries. Coordinate domestic and international shipping. Purchase supplies and
    equipment.
  • Assist with hiring and supervisions of student employees (academic hourlies, graduate and research
    assistants).
  • Have access to and maintain electronic programs related to admissions, course scheduling, inventory,
    purchasing and payroll.
  • Attend and participate in campus meetings where appropriate and related to the incumbent's tasks
  • Send out weekly email announcements and other event publicity announcements across campus, maintains database of faculty, students, staff institutions and other interested individuals. Process and disseminates course lists for courses related study of relevant region.
  • Perform other duties as assigned to further the mission of the units
